Illustration of a common pheasant, or ring-necked pheasant (Phasianus colchicus), by an unidentified artist, late 19th century. The body of the species is formed by real bird feathers; the remainder of the picture is supplied with watercolor. The image depicts the pheasant perched upon a small stub of a tree. The back of the sheet is inscribed: "Phasianus colchicus."
A description of how to make similarly constructed pictures of birds with natural feathers is given in: Elegant arts for ladies (London : Ward and Lock, 1861).
Cased with a similar picture of a black-hooded oriole, presumably by the same creator.
